Tasting notes
Vivid magenta. Highly perfumed, mineral-tinged aromas of ripe red and blue fruits, cherry-cola and succulent flowers expand with aeration. Offers palate-staining raspberry liqueur, cherry pie and boysenberry flavors that are accompanied by a lavender pastille nuance and hints of woodsmoke and licorice. Rich but extremely lively as well, showing impressive back-end thrust, youthfully chewy tannins that add shape and firm grip to clinging berry and cherry notes.

Sweetly fruited, opulent, and a hedonistic bomb, the 2017 Rising Tides (64% Grenache, 28% Syrah, 8% Carignan) gives up loads of sweet strawberry and blackberry fruit intermixed with notes of spice, incense, and peppery herbs. Ripe, flamboyant, seamless, and straight-up silky and sexy, it should keep for 7-8 years, yet I see no need to delay gratification on this one.
